Name and State of Domicile of Surviving Corporation Sample Clauses

Name and State of Domicile of Surviving Corporation. At and after the Effective Time, the Surviving Corporation shall continue to be named "Nationwide Life Insurance Company" and the state of domicile shall remain the State of Ohio. The principal offices of the Surviving Corporation in Ohio shall continue to be Xxx Xxxxxxxxxx Xxxxx, Xxxxxxxx, Xxxx 00000.

Name and State of Domicile of Surviving Corporation. Simultaneously with the effectiveness of the Merger, the Articles of Incorporation of the Surviving Corporation shall be amended to change the name of the Surviving Corporation to “RiverSource Life Insurance Company” and the state of domicile shall remain the state of Minnesota.
Name and State of Domicile of Surviving Corporation. Upon the effectiveness of the merger, the name of the Surviving Corporation shall remain Merrxxx Xxxcx Xxxe Insurance Company and the state of domicile shall remain the State of Arkansas.
Name and State of Domicile of Surviving Corporation. Upon the effectiveness of the merger, the name of the Surviving Corporation shall remain Protective Life Insurance Company and the state of domicile shall remain the State of Tennessee.

  • Certificate of Limited Partnership The General Partner has caused the Certificate of Limited Partnership to be filed with the Secretary of State of the State of Delaware as required by the Delaware Act. The General Partner shall use all reasonable efforts to cause to be filed such other certificates or documents that the General Partner determines to be necessary or appropriate for the formation, continuation, qualification and operation of a limited partnership (or a partnership in which the limited partners have limited liability) in the State of Delaware or any other state in which the Partnership may elect to do business or own property. To the extent the General Partner determines such action to be necessary or appropriate, the General Partner shall file amendments to and restatements of the Certificate of Limited Partnership and do all things to maintain the Partnership as a limited partnership (or a partnership or other entity in which the limited partners have limited liability) under the laws of the State of Delaware or of any other state in which the Partnership may elect to do business or own property. Subject to the terms of Section 3.4(a), the General Partner shall not be required, before or after filing, to deliver or mail a copy of the Certificate of Limited Partnership, any qualification document or any amendment thereto to any Limited Partner.
